The name of the recipient of this letter was not released.
B”H, 9 Elul, 5710
Greetings and blessings,
In reply to your letter of 20 Menachem Av informing [me] that you and your wife have agreed to join a group that are journeying to settle in our Holy Land. You add that if you find a position in the field of mathematics [there], it appears to you that [the offer] should not be rejected and you request a blessing for this.
May it be [G‑d’s] will that you be a medium for the blessings of my revered father-in-law, the Rebbe, הכ"מ, that your journey be satisfactory, and that you reach your destination successfully. “Man’s footsteps are established by G‑d and He shall favor his way.” 1
There is a well-known saying of my revered father-in-law, the Rebbe, הכ"מ, to a person who was journeying to our Holy Land: “Make Eretz Yisrael into a holy land.” We are not aware of the secret of [the path destined for each person to] refine [the material entities designated for him], as [implied by] the well-known statement of our Sages: 2 “A person does not know how he will earn his livelihood....” This also involves one’s spiritual livelihood. Nevertheless, making Eretz Yisrael into a holy land by becoming a math teacher appears to be a very distant path. Mashiach is “standing behind our wall,” 3 waiting for the completion of the task of refinement in this era of ikvesa diMeshicha.
With blessings for a kesivah vachasimah tovah and that your journey to your destination will be satisfactory for you and for your wife,
Menachem Schneerson
